Education Week: State, Local Policies Seen to Slow Personalized Learning - 0 views

  • K-12 education is at a policy crossroads, experts in educational technology policy say, as seat-time requirements, school funding models, textbook-adoption procedures, and teacher-certification requirements restrict the growth and effectiveness of emerging learning methods.
  • Moves to replace seat-time mandates, which set the amount of time students must spend in a class before completing it, with requirements that students demonstrate competency in the skills needed to master the course appear to be gaining traction
  • But some policy experts caution that a complete abolition of seat-time requirements could adversely affect the social and collaborative aspects of learning
